Web3 Labs Joins Hyperledger Foundation, Providing Hyperledger Besu Support

Web3 Labs proudly pronounces its official membership within the Hyperledger Basis, a worldwide collaborative effort advancing cross-industry enterprise-grade blockchain applied sciences. This strategic transfer underscores Web3 Labs’ dedication to fostering the event and adoption of Hyperledger Besu, the one Ethereum consumer designed for each mainnet and personal community use instances.

Conor Svensson, CEO, and Founding father of Web3 Labs, expressed enthusiasm for the collaboration, stating, “The Web3 Labs team is very excited about the upcoming modularity of consensus mechanisms in Hyperledger Besu. This will make it easier to separate out changes to Besu that are driven by the Ethereum mainnet at its consensus layer and those relevant for permissioned network deployments. This sort of modularity is great as it will ensure Besu can serve its user bases even better than it already does.”

Web3 Labs has been a key participant on this group because the pre-Hyperledger days when Besu was often known as Pantheon. Svensson famous, “As authors of Web3j, the leading JVM integration library for Ethereum, there’s always been a natural affinity with Hyperledger Besu given it also uses the JVM. Hence Besu uses features from Web3j, and Web3j uses features from Besu.”

Web3 Labs is formally acknowledged as maintainers of Hyperledger Besu and in addition takes delight in collaborating in  the Linux Basis’s Hyperledger Mentor Program, serving as mentors for a mission centered on performance and benchmarking analysis of Hyperledger Besu using Hyperledger Caliper.

Highlighting the the reason why Web3 Labs considers Hyperledger Besu probably the most future-proof blockchain platform, Svensson famous, “Hyperledger Besu is the only Ethereum client designed for both mainnet and private network use cases. This duality ensures there is a trickle-down effect of features from mainnet being available to private networks.”

He additional emphasised some great benefits of being a Hyperledger mission, stating, “Being a Hyperledger project ensures that the life of the project will outlive any single commercial entity, and its licensing model will not change to a less permissive model.”

Web3 Labs provides business help companies for Hyperledger Besu networks, making certain organisations working or planning to run permissioned blockchain networks profit from environment friendly problem decision. Web3 Labs is ConsenSys’ recommended Hyperledger Besu supplier. As well as, the Web3 Labs blockchain explorer, Chainlens, is intently built-in with Besu and different Ethereum shoppers.

Daniela Barbosa, Government Director, Hyperledger Basis, and Common Supervisor Blockchain and Identification on the Linux Basis, welcomed Web3 Labs, stating, “The team at Web3 Labs has been contributing to Hyperledger Besu and the overall Ethereum ecosystem for years. Now, as a General Member, they are adding an extra level of investment and commitment to the long-term growth and health of Hyperledger technologies. As more and more enterprises adopt Hyperledger platforms, tools and libraries, the work Hyperledger Foundation does around governance, security, reliability, transparency and overall software stewardship increases in importance. As a new member, Web3 Labs is helping ensure the longevity of Hyperledger Besu and our other projects.”
